Counting the tuples with this word is more efficient than calling " { $link length } " on the result of " { $link select-tuples } "." } ; { select-tuple select-tuples count-tuples } related-words ARTICLE: "db-tuples" "High-level tuple/database integration" "Start with a tutorial:" { $subsection "db-tuples-tutorial" } "Database types supported:" { $subsection "db.types" } "Useful words:" { $subsection "db-tuples-words" } "For porting db.tuples to other databases:" { $subsection "db-tuples-protocol" } ; ARTICLE: "db-tuples-words" "High-level tuple/database words" "Making tuples work with a database:" { $subsection define-persistent } "Creating tables:" { $subsection create-table } { $subsection ensure-table } { $subsection ensure-tables } { $subsection recreate-table } "Dropping tables:" { $subsection drop-table } "Inserting a tuple:" { $subsection insert-tuple } "Updating a tuple:" { $subsection update-tuple } "Deleting tuples:" { $subsection delete-tuples } "Querying tuples:" { $subsection select-tuple } { $subsection select-tuples } { $subsection count-tuples } ; ARTICLE: "db-tuples-protocol" "Tuple database protocol" "Creating a table:" { $subsection create-sql-statement } "Dropping a table:" { $subsection drop-sql-statement } "Inserting a tuple:" { $subsection } { $subsection } "Updating a tuple:" { $subsection } "Deleting tuples:" { $subsection } "Selecting tuples:" { $subsection } "Counting tuples:" { $subsection } ; ARTICLE: "db-tuples-tutorial" "Tuple database tutorial" "Let's make a tuple and store it in a database. To follow along, click on each code example and run it in the listener. If you forget to run an example, just start at the top and run them all again in order." $nl "We're going to store books in this tutorial." { $code "TUPLE: book id title author date-published edition cover-price condition ;" } "The title, author, and publisher should be strings; the date-published a timestamp; the edition an integer; the cover-price a float. These are the Factor types for which we will need to look up the corresponding " { $link "db.types" } ". " $nl "To actually bind the tuple slots to the database types, we'll use " { $link define-persistent } "." { $code <" USING: db.tuples db.types ; book "BOOK" { { "id" "ID" +db-assigned-id+ } { "title" "TITLE" VARCHAR } { "author" "AUTHOR" VARCHAR } { "date-published" "DATE_PUBLISHED" TIMESTAMP } { "edition" "EDITION" INTEGER } { "cover-price" "COVER_PRICE" DOUBLE } { "condition" "CONDITION" VARCHAR } } define-persistent "> } "That's all we'll have to do with the database for this tutorial. Now let's make a book." { $code <" USING: calendar namespaces ; T{ book { title "Factor for Sheeple" } { author "Mister Stacky Pants" } { date-published T{ timestamp { year 2009 } { month 3 } { day 3 } } } { edition 1 } { cover-price 13.37 } } book set "> } "Now we've created a book. Let's save it to the database." { $code <" USING: db db.sqlite fry io.files ; : with-book-tutorial ( quot -- ) '[ "book-tutorial.db" temp-file _ with-db ] call ; [ book recreate-table book get insert-tuple ] with-book-tutorial "> } "Is it really there?" { $code <" [ T{ book { title "Factor for Sheeple" } } select-tuples . ] with-book-tutorial "> } "Oops, we spilled some orange juice on the book cover." { $code <" book get "Small orange juice stain on cover" >>condition "> } "Now let's save the modified book." { $code <" [ book get update-tuple ] with-book-tutorial "> } "And select it again. You can query the database by any field -- just set it in the exemplar tuple you pass to " { $link select-tuples } "." { $code <" [ T{ book { title "Factor for Sheeple" } } select-tuples ] with-book-tutorial "> } "Let's drop the table because we're done." { $code <" [ book drop-table ] with-book-tutorial "> } "To summarize, the steps for using Factor's tuple database are:" { $list "Make a new tuple to represent your data" { "Map the Factor types to the database types with " { $link define-persistent } } { "Make a custom database combinator (see" { $link "db-custom-database-combinators" } ") to open your database and run a " { $link quotation } } { "Create a table with " { $link create-table } ", " { $link ensure-table } ", or " { $link recreate-table } } { "Start making and storing objects with " { $link insert-tuple } ", " { $link update-tuple } ", " { $link delete-tuples } ", and " { $link select-tuples } } } ; ABOUT: "db-tuples"
